I’ve spoken to you in times past concerning faith and salvation by faith, and I’ve explained the difference between believing and having faith. I can believe, but that doesn’t mean that I have faith. See, I can believe. I must believe just to live. I must believe that I can stand up. I must believe that I can sit down. I must believe that I can speak. See, I must believe that I can take from my plate and feed my mouth. I must believe that. I must believe that that’s a tree. I must believe that that’s a river. I must believe because you have to believe, but that doesn’t mean that you’ve got faith. See, the secret of faith is differentiating between believing and faith. The difference is that you believe up here in your head, from the contact of your human senses, from seeing and smelling and tasting and feeling you believe. The difference between believing and faith is that faith is in the heart. Faith is not a result of your seeing and hearing, so far as your natural senses. That’s not what faith is. Faith is the results of that connection with God. You’ve got to make that connection with God. You say, “But Brother Pike, I hear.” But how is it that the Bible says having ears to hear, you do not hear? It means that it’s not the hearing of natural things. There is a spiritual thing that comes to the church where they have a spiritual ear to hear, they have a spiritual eye to see, and their faith is the result of their contact with God. My believing, or what you call faith in the natural, is the result of my natural conscience mind making contact with the world. That’s believing. That’s what you call faith. My believing, my faith, my real genuine faith comes from the eyes of my understanding being enlightened, and from having an ear to hear. The Bible says faith cometh by hearing, and hearing by the Word of God.

You may hear the Word of God as a natural oral expression, but that does not mean that you have faith. When you hear what the Spirit is saying unto the church according to the Word of Spirit, and it is not the minister that speaks, but you hear God speaking, for the Bible says that it’s not him speaking but God speaking, then comes faith. That stirs the heart. That makes a contact with the heart.
